Comprehending the Difference: Cot vs. Cot Bed
Before diving into shopping, it is valuable to understand the terminology. While lots of individuals utilize "cot" tots and cots "cot bed" interchangeably, there is a distinct practical distinction:
Standard Cot: Generally smaller sized with repaired sides, designed to fit infants from birth until they are roughly 18 months to 2 years old.Cot Bed: Slightly larger and designed to grow with the child. Cot beds typically feature detachable sides and convertible ends, permitting them to transform into a toddler bed suitable for kids up to 4 or even 5 years of age.
Why a cheap cot bed is a wise financial move: Because cot beds last substantially longer than standard top rated cots, buying a budget-friendly cot bed typically offers much better long-term value for money.
Key Features to Look for in Budget Cot Beds
When shopping on a budget, it is easy to assume that lower costs suggest compromised quality. However, when it concerns nursery furnishings, price is typically dictated by trademark name, complicated systems, or premium surfaces instead of structural safety.
To make sure a cheap cot Beds cot bed meets your needs, keep the following important functions in mind:
Safety Certifications: Never compromise on security. In the UK and Europe, search for safety standard BS EN 716. For Australia and New Zealand, look for AS/NZS 2172. These accreditations guarantee the slats are spaced correctly (to avoid a baby's head from getting stuck), the paint is non-toxic, and the structure is stable.Adjustable Mattress Base Heights: A great cot bed need to provide several mattress base positions (normally 3). High position: For newborns, making it simple to raise the baby without straining your back.Low position: For when the baby finds out to sit and pull themselves up, avoiding unexpected falls.Teething Rails: Babies enjoy to chew on everything, including their furniture. Search for smooth, non-toxic teething rails along the leading edges to protect both your baby's gums and the finish of the bed.Material Quality: Budget cot beds are frequently made from solid pine or crafted wood (MDF). Strong pine is durable, lightweight, and naturally cost effective, making it the most popular option for economical nursery furnishings.Comparing Types of Cheap Cot Beds

Easy, clean-lined geometric styles are cheaper to manufacture and frequently look a lot more contemporary.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Are cheap cot beds safe for babies?
Yes, absolutely. In areas with rigorous production guidelines, all cots to tots and cot beds-- despite their rate tag-- need to lawfully pass extensive security tests. A cheap cot bed that fulfills security requirements (such as BS EN 716) is simply as safe for a newborn as a pricey designer design.
2. Do I require to purchase a brand-new bed mattress?
Yes. Health companies highly advise purchasing a new mattress for every single new baby. Secondhand bed mattress can harbor dust termites, bacteria, and irritants, and they may have lost their firmness, which increases the risk of Sudden Infant Death Syndrome (SIDS).
3. For how long will an inexpensive cot bed really last?
A basic cot bed can usually be used from birth until your child is around 4 years of ages (or reaches a weight limit specified by the producer, generally around 25 to 30 kg). By removing the sides, it transforms into a toddler bed, stretching its usability well past the life-span of a conventional crib.
4. Is assembly tough for budget plan cot beds?
The majority of spending plan cot beds are created for simple home assembly. Since they generally feature easier styles with less moving parts (preventing complicated drop-side mechanisms, for instance), they are often uncomplicated to put together with basic family tools.
